Position : Dock Worker
Location : Grand Falls-Windsor, NL
Pay : $19 / hr
Shift : Sunday to Thursday, 12am – 8am.
Advantages
Full-time employment with a leading company in the manufacturing & logistics industry.
Consistent schedule from Sunday to Thursday, 12 AM to 8 AM.
Competitive hourly wage of $19.00.
Positive and supportive work environment.
Responsibilities
Perform LTL (Less-than-Truckload) loading and unloading of trucks, ensuring cargo is secured and handled with care.
Manually lift and move freight weighing up to 50 lbs
Inspect products for damage and ensure accuracy of shipments.
Maintain a clean and organized work area, adhering to all safety protocols and company policies.
Collaborate with team members in a respectful and professional manner.
Conduct daily safety checks on forklifts and report any maintenance issues.
Ensure all warehouse tasks are completed accurately and on schedule.
Qualifications
Proven experience in forklift operation and certification (an asset).
Strong understanding of warehouse operations and safety procedures.
Ability to handle physical work, including lifting heavy items.
Excellent time management and organizational skills.
Attention to detail and a commitment to accuracy.
Safety-minded and respectful demeanor.
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
